Monaco is one of Formula 1’s great challenges. The traffic is monstrous – and that’s just when you’ve got 20 cars fighting for position around the tight, twisty and barrier-lined street track.
Drivers need to beware of slower cars when on a hot lap – no easy feat when there are several blind corners and only a narrow path to thread your way past. Misjudge and it’s lap over. There’s a bottleneck in the final segment during qualifying, too, as drivers back up to give themselves some clear air to push for a flying lap.
